A horse racecourse is in the form of an annular ring whose outer and inner circumferences are 748 m and 396 m. respectively. The width (in m) of the racecourse is: (Take `pi = (22)/7`)

A

176

B

88

C

56

D

28

Text Solution

AI Generated Solution

The correct Answer is:
To find the width of the horse racecourse, which is in the form of an annular ring, we need to determine the radii of the outer and inner circles using their circumferences. ### Step-by-Step Solution: 1. **Identify the formulas and given data:** - The formula for the circumference of a circle is given by: \[ C = 2 \pi r \] - Given outer circumference \(C_{outer} = 748 \, m\) and inner circumference \(C_{inner} = 396 \, m\). - We will take \(\pi = \frac{22}{7}\). 2. **Calculate the outer radius \(R\):** - Using the outer circumference: \[ C_{outer} = 2 \pi R \] Substituting the values: \[ 748 = 2 \times \frac{22}{7} \times R \] - Rearranging to find \(R\): \[ R = \frac{748 \times 7}{2 \times 22} \] - Simplifying: \[ R = \frac{748 \times 7}{44} = \frac{5236}{44} = 119 \, m \] 3. **Calculate the inner radius \(r\):** - Using the inner circumference: \[ C_{inner} = 2 \pi r \] Substituting the values: \[ 396 = 2 \times \frac{22}{7} \times r \] - Rearranging to find \(r\): \[ r = \frac{396 \times 7}{2 \times 22} \] - Simplifying: \[ r = \frac{396 \times 7}{44} = \frac{2772}{44} = 63 \, m \] 4. **Calculate the width of the racecourse:** - The width of the racecourse is the difference between the outer radius and inner radius: \[ \text{Width} = R - r = 119 - 63 = 56 \, m \] ### Final Answer: The width of the racecourse is \(56 \, m\). ---
